Understanding the Role of Food Tourism in Exploring Chinese Cuisine in the US

August 12, 2025

1 - How Food Tourism Connects Culture and Cuisine

Food tourism isn’t just about eating — it’s about connecting with history, traditions, and the people behind the dishes. When travelers seek out Chinese cuisine in the US, they’re not only tasting dumplings or noodles but also engaging with centuries of culinary heritage. This connection transforms a simple meal into a cultural exchange, where flavors tell stories of migration, adaptation, and preservation.

2 - Regional Diversity of Chinese Cuisine in the US

The role of food tourism in exploring Chinese cuisine becomes even richer when you consider its regional diversity. From spicy Sichuan hotpots in Los Angeles to delicate Cantonese dim sum in New York, the US offers an extraordinary range of authentic Chinese dishes. Cities like San Francisco and Chicago host neighborhoods where regional specialties thrive, creating immersive experiences for curious food travelers.

3 - The Rise of Culinary Tours and Dining Experiences

In recent years, organized culinary tours have gained popularity, guiding visitors through vibrant Chinatowns, hidden neighborhood eateries, and modern Chinese fusion restaurants. These experiences often include cooking demonstrations, historical walking tours, and behind-the-scenes access to family-run kitchens. Such tours have become a cornerstone of food tourism, giving travelers context along with flavor.

4 - Real Stories of Food Travelers

One traveler from Seattle shared how her cross-country trip was planned around tasting different versions of hand-pulled noodles. From a rustic Lanzhou-style shop in Boston to a bustling modern eatery in Houston, she documented the subtle changes in texture, flavor, and presentation. These kinds of journeys highlight how food tourism turns eating into a meaningful exploration.

5 - How to Find Authentic Chinese Food in the US

For those eager to explore, starting with local recommendations and trusted guides is key. Seek out areas known for strong Chinese communities, follow food bloggers who specialize in authentic dining, and try to sample dishes from multiple regions of China.
